How the example is built up
- Start from the duty cycle, not from the catalogue photograph.
- Fix the base material in writing — Carbon Steel, in this example.
- List the dimensions that are actually controlled and the tolerance on each.
- Name the finish and what it has to survive.
- State the inspection level and who pays when a lot fails.

Checks before packing
- Dimensional report against the approved drawing.
- AQL 1.5 sampling on the finished lot.
- Finish inspection under agreed lighting.
- Carton drop test on the first lot of a new packing specification.
